The government minister Meka Whaitiri has formally announced her defection from Labour.

She will stand for Te Pāti Māori in the Ikaroa-Rāwhiti electorate, which she currently holds.

Speaking at Waipatu Marae in Hastings, Ms Whaitiri said the decision to cross the floor was not an easy one, but was the right one.

She said her resignation from Labour is effective immediately, and she will sit with Te Pāti Māori when it returns to parliament.
